Riboflavin
Riboflavin (Vitamin B2) is an essential micronutrient and endogenous metabolite that serves as the precursor for the coenzymes FMN and FAD. It is critical in cellular energy production, redox metabolism, and antibody synthesis, making it a key compound for in vitro biochemical assays and in vivo studies of nutrition, metabolism, and mitochondrial function.
